Output 566feb788efa092a709c5a7b2a868e606873056e1e4b20c849fbc67a3c08855e:1

value
14379818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75df48405611942a465a3e4e833100a94061f403 OP_EQUAL
address
3CSGTuhJQbTpAus99AA7rcX2TRy82LYV52
transaction
566feb788efa092a709c5a7b2a868e606873056e1e4b20c849fbc67a3c08855e
spent
false

26 Sat Ranges